Autistic and Orphaned. The nation’s survival depends on her.
Seventeen-year-old Aimee Louise doesn't see faces; instead she sees swirling, shifting clouds. Bright and fluffy for happiness; dark gray for sadness, and anxious, restless wisps of gray for worry. But a sharp, jagged, crimson cloud, a chilling, almost tangible weight in the air, screams of imminent danger.
A local transformer explodes, but it’s only the beginning of the coordinated, widespread collapse of the nation’s grid and the economy. When the power-hungry criminal discovers the information to stop his plan to take over the US government is hidden at her grandfather’s farm, the attacks escalate and become personal. His target is Aimee Louise.
Aimee Louise is single minded: save the family. Her enemy is single minded: kill Aimee Louise.
A YA Novel of Survival
THE GIRL WHO SAW CLOUDS is the same story as DANGER IN THE CLOUDS, except the story is told from the viewpoint of 17-year-old Aimee Louise, who is Major Dave Elliott's granddaughter.
